Comprehending Door Handles and Their Components
Door handles are made up of a number of parts, each serving a specific purpose. The primary components of a normal door handle consist of:

Replacing a door handle is a simple procedure that can be accomplished with some fundamental tools and knowledge. The list below actions outline how to change door handle parts efficiently:
Tools Required:Screwdriver (flathead and Phillips)Allen wrench (if relevant)Drill (for new installations)LevelMeasuring tapeReplacement handle setStep-by-Step Guide:
Remove the Old Handle:
Begin by unscrewing the handle using the proper screwdriver. If there are concealed screws, you might need to pry off the rosette or escutcheon to access them.As soon as the screws are removed, separate the 2 halves of the handle.
Get Rid Of the Latch Mechanism:
Unscrew the latch mechanism from the edge of the door. Pull it out carefully to prevent harming the door.
Place the New Latch:
Position the brand-new lock mechanism in the very same slot, guaranteeing it aligns with the door's edge and screw holes for a safe and secure fit.
Install the New Handle:
Slide the spindle through the latch and link both halves of the handle. Secure them with screws.If there's a rosette or trim piece, reattach it to cover any exposed screws.
Check the Mechanism:
Ensure that the handle operates efficiently and the latch engages effectively with the strike plate.Make any necessary changes.

Q1: How do I know which replacement parts I need for my door handle?A: Identify the type and brand name of your present handle, and check the measurements for the spindle length, lock size, and general handle style. Many hardware shops can assist match parts by providing sample fittings.
Q2: Can I change a door handle without professional aid?A: Yes, replacing a door handle is a workable DIY job. Follow the actions laid out above, and use caution with tools to ensure safety.
Q3: What should I do if my door handle is not basic size?A: If you find your door handle is non-standard, consider checking out a specialty hardware shop or online merchant that uses custom-made or universal door handle solutions.
